Job summary

IMP Aerospace & Defence is seeking an Avionics Engineer to support life‑cycle management of avionics/electrical systems. You will assist design, repair, monitoring, and improvement recommendations under the Avionics Engineering Supervisor.

The role involves liaising with customers, management, and multiple departments to ensure airworthiness, cost effectiveness, and contract compliance at the Halifax area facility near the international airport.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or level engineering degree in avionics/electrical engineering is required.
  • Eligible for ENS registration or equivalent is preferred.
  • Ability to work independently and in a team environment.

Responsibilities

  • Liaise with customers and management to ensure airworthiness and contract compliance.
  • Analyze design deficiencies and recommend rectifications.
  • Represent the company at technical meetings with customers or manufacturers.
  • Prepare and review Statements of Work and engineering reports.
  • Provide technical advice and support for life-cycle management of avionics/electrical systems.
